What is Wellness Parent/Child Agreement
The Middle School Wellness Parent/Child Agreement is a personal contract used by the Valparaiso Family YMCA to outline policies for parents and children participating in wellness programs together.

Who is eligible to sign the Middle School Wellness Parent/Child Agreement?
Both the parent and child must sign the agreement to participate in the wellness program. Additionally, a staff member from the wellness team will also need to sign it for validation.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the agreement?
While there isn't a specific deadline mentioned, it’s essential to submit the agreement before the child starts participating in the wellness program to ensure compliance with program rules.
